HAIR's Costume Designer, Tony Award nominee Michael McDonald will design a HAIR-themed backpack for the Project Backpack Auction on Sept 13. Some of the best designers from Broadway, Project Runway and fashion come out to design one of a kind backpacks for Help Is On The Way Today's Project Backpack drive designer auction. Help Is On The Way Today is a non-for-profit organization that helps and assists children living with HIV and AIDS in New York City. The mission of the organization is to step in when government agencies fall short. Founded by Joseph Macchia in 2006, Help Is On The Way Today works with clinics, hospitals, and group homes in the Tri State Area.
